Loss of balance is one of the most serious changes after 70. It’s caused not only by muscle loss, but also by changes in vision, the inner ear, and reaction time.

The encouraging news: simple balance training can lower fall risk by nearly half.

Examples

Standing on one foot while holding a chair

Walking heel-to-toe in a straight line

Gentle tai chi or slow, controlled movements

Balance is about coordination—not strength alone.

5. Protein plays a key role in preserving muscle

After 70, muscle loss accelerates even if eating habits stay the same. This process, called sarcopenia, contributes to weakness, fatigue, and reduced independence.

Two factors matter most:

Adequate protein intake

Regular muscle stimulation through movement

Protein should be spread across the day—not concentrated in one meal.
